Output 0058e7be58353dfa08deee71b53d9217f901f3e1f223d01bc72a3c5d960e24cc:309

value
105319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a15602b7733778d021ffc544654dae50c3f3a5a OP_EQUAL
address
3EH8nDv1StSmEU5fDtrPgzQ5HPYMUCygkb
transaction
0058e7be58353dfa08deee71b53d9217f901f3e1f223d01bc72a3c5d960e24cc
spent
true